The Core Composition of Honey: Mostly Sugar, Not Protein
When we analyze the nutritional makeup of honey, the results are clear. Honey is, first and foremost, a concentrated source of carbohydrates, primarily in the form of the simple sugars fructose and glucose. A typical 100-gram serving of honey contains over 80 grams of carbohydrates and provides over 300 calories, with less than 1% of its weight coming from protein. The small amount of protein present is derived from bees and pollen and consists mainly of enzymes and amino acids, with proline being the most abundant.
Why Honey's Protein Content Isn't What It Seems
The trace amounts of protein and amino acids in honey are not used by the human body for muscle building or cellular repair in the same way as the protein from other dietary sources. Instead, they function more like enzymes or play other minor, non-structural roles. Honey's key value lies in its antioxidant and antimicrobial properties, not its protein contribution. Minimally processed or raw honey retains more of these beneficial plant compounds, but this does not increase its protein count to a substantial level.
Honey vs. Common Protein Sources: A Nutritional Comparison
To put honey's protein content into perspective, it helps to compare it directly with foods known for their protein density. The table below illustrates the vast difference.
| Food (per 100g) | Protein Content | Notes | 
|---|---|---|
| Honey | ~0.3g | Primarily sugar and carbohydrates; protein is negligible. | 
| Chicken Breast | ~31g | Excellent source of high-quality, complete protein for building and repairing muscle. | 
| Lentils | ~9g | Plant-based protein source, also high in fiber and other nutrients. | 
| Greek Yogurt | ~10g | Dairy source of protein, also provides calcium and probiotics. | 
| Eggs | ~13g | Complete protein source, contains all essential amino acids. | 
| Broccoli | ~2.8g | Offers more protein than honey per 100g, along with fiber and vitamins. | 
The Takeaway from the Table
As the table clearly demonstrates, relying on honey for your protein intake would be highly impractical and nutritionally unsound. You would need to consume an enormous and unhealthy quantity of honey to get the same amount of protein found in a single serving of chicken or lentils. The purpose of incorporating honey into your diet should be for its sweetness, antioxidant content, or as a natural alternative to refined sugar, not for its nonexistent protein-boosting capabilities.
How to Maximize Honey's Role in a Balanced Diet
For those seeking a nutritious balance, using honey in conjunction with genuine protein sources is the ideal approach. Here are a few ways to effectively use honey while prioritizing your protein goals:
- Drizzle over Greek Yogurt: Combine the sweetness of honey with a high-protein, creamy base for a satisfying snack.
- Add to a Protein Smoothie: Blend honey with protein powder, milk, and fruits to enhance flavor without relying on it for the protein component.
- Use in Marinades and Dressings: A small amount of honey can add a unique sweetness to a meat marinade or salad dressing, complementing the protein in the meal.
- Mix with Nut Butters: A classic combination on whole-grain toast provides a balance of carbs, healthy fats, and some protein.
- Combine with Nuts and Seeds: Create a granola or trail mix with honey for binding, while nuts and seeds provide the primary protein source.
A Concluding Perspective on Honey and Protein
In conclusion, the answer to the question "Does honey add protein?" is a definitive no, at least in any nutritionally meaningful way. While honey contains trace amounts of proteins and amino acids, these are insignificant for meeting the body's daily protein requirements. Honey's true nutritional value lies in its role as an antioxidant-rich, natural sweetener that offers a more nutritious alternative to refined sugars. For building and repairing tissues, or for fueling muscle growth, you should turn to established high-protein foods like lean meats, dairy, legumes, and nuts. By understanding the distinct roles of different food components, you can make smarter, more informed dietary choices to meet all your nutritional needs.
